What Is the JOMA Style Blade System?
The JOMA Style Blade System features individual steel segments with tungsten carbide inserts encased in shock-absorbing rubber. This design allows articulation across uneven road surfaces for superior snow clearing. How Does Articulation Improve Snow Removal?
Articulation allows each blade segment to follow road contours, scraping snow and ice more completely than rigid edges. When snow plows clear roads, the surface is not always flat. Articulation means that the blade is made in segments that can move independently, allowing each part to follow the shape of the road. This helps the plow remove snow and ice more completely than a single rigid blade. As a result, less salt is needed to keep roads safe, which can save money and reduce environmental impact.

Why Does It Reduce Noise and Vibration?
The rubber encasing combined with segment articulation absorbs shocks and dampens impact. This reduces cabin noise, lowers driver fatigue, and decreases wear on plow equipment. How Does It Extend Blade Life?
Tungsten carbide inserts are brazed into steel and protected by rubber and curbrunners, providing up to 4.5 seasons of use. Why Choose Carbide Over Steel for Durability?
Carbide inserts deliver superior abrasion resistance compared to steel, maintaining sharpness against ice and packed snow. Rubber protection prevents edge damage and reduces vibration.
